Cooper Bussmann SR-5 Series

Cooper Bussmann SR-5 series time-delay subminiature fuses are an ideal PCB fuse solution and can be used within a wide variety of applications.

Internationally accepted for primary and secondary overcurrent protection
High inrush withstand capability
Compatible with leaded and lead-free reflow and wave solder
